How Your Career Industry Affects Singapore PR Application

The pursuit of a Permanent Residency (PR) in Singapore is a journey marked by various considerations, and one of the pivotal factors that can influence the outcome is your chosen profession. Singapore’s PR application process considers the contributions applicants can make to the nation’s growth and development. 

This article delves into the ways different career industries may impact the approval or rejection of Singapore PR applications, providing insights for individuals navigating this intricate process.

Overview of Career Industry Considerations

Singapore places a premium on attracting talent that aligns with its economic and societal objectives. As such, the career industry of an applicant becomes a critical factor in the PR application process. The Immigration and Checkpoints Authority (ICA) evaluates how an individual’s skills, expertise, and contributions fit into the broader context of Singapore’s development.

High-Demand Industries and Their Impact

Certain industries are deemed in high demand due to their significance in driving Singapore’s economy. Professions in technology, finance, healthcare, and engineering, among others, often experience a more favorable reception during the PR application process. The demand for talent in these sectors contributes to a higher likelihood of approval, given the nation’s emphasis on bolstering these industries.

Some key sectors that have traditionally been important for Singapore’s economic development and that may continue to be in focus include:

Technology and Innovation

Embracing digital transformation and fostering innovation is crucial for Singapore’s competitiveness on the global stage. Investments in research and development, smart technologies, and fostering a culture of innovation contribute to economic growth.

Finance and FinTech

As a global financial hub, Singapore continues to focus on the financial services sector. The government has been supportive of financial technology (FinTech) initiatives, aiming to maintain its status as a leading financial centre and drive the adoption of digital financial services.

Biomedical Sciences and Healthcare

Given the global emphasis on healthcare, Singapore has been investing in biomedical research, pharmaceuticals, and healthcare services. This sector not only contributes to economic growth but also enhances Singapore’s capabilities in addressing health challenges.

Advanced Manufacturing

Singapore has been promoting advanced manufacturing, including areas such as precision engineering, aerospace, and electronics. The goal is to move up the value chain in manufacturing, emphasizing high-tech and high-value-added production.

Sustainable Development and Environmental Solutions

In line with global efforts towards sustainability, Singapore has been increasingly focusing on environmental solutions, clean energy, and sustainable development. This includes initiatives to enhance energy efficiency, reduce carbon emissions, and promote green technologies.

Logistics and Supply Chain Management

Singapore’s strategic location and well-developed infrastructure make it a key player in global logistics. Enhancing logistics and supply chain capabilities is important for supporting international trade and commerce.

Tourism and Hospitality

While the tourism sector has faced challenges, Singapore has been consistently working on strategies to attract visitors. The country’s vibrant tourism and hospitality industry contributes significantly to its economy.
